Tutoriel détecteur LD2450 esphome

Pas mal comme carte.

Mais la zone de coverage ne correspond pas à la réalité des paramètres. A gauche, la carte avec le code que j’avais chopé je ne sais ou. A droite celle du github.

Je viens juste de regarder, c’est modifiable. Mais avec ma compréhension du template c’est juste lourd … En gros le coverage est juste dessiné avec des valeurs en dur.

Je regarderai si j’ai le temps de faire plus propre en reprenant les valeurs de config du capteur type : Zone1 X-Begin, etc…
Mais je promet rien je suis loin d’être calé.

Finalement j’ai pris un exemplaire à 15€ pour faire des essais. Première impression : il est gros !

1 « J'aime »

Bonjour à vous. Juste un petit retour sur mes détections fantôme la nuit (2 ou 3)
Je viens de le remplacer et depuis qq jours plus de détections fantômes.
Je sais pas si y a quelque chose à y faire :slight_smile:

Sinon j’ai un autre 2450 ou le Bluetooth à l’air de pas fonctionner, n’est pas détecté par hlk tool. Y a t’il un endroit pour activer la wifi ? Merci à vous bonne journée

As-tu regardé si tu es déclenchement fantôme étaient cyclique ?

J’avais des détections fantômes dans des pièces où j’ai d’autres matériels électroniques. Par exemple dans la cuisine, lorsque le frigo se remet en marche, j’avais un déclenchement fantôme.
J’ai réglé le problème en mettant la zone du frigo en exclusion

Salut, merci pour ta reponse,
Hier soir j’ai reactivé la multi detection de personne dans hlk tool et cette nuit j’ai eu 2 declanchement fantome

Comment trouves tu l’historique de position?

Merci
Bonne journée a toi

D’abord tu vas dans « Paramètres », puis dans « Appareils et services », puis « ESP Home ».
Tu cliques sur les entités de ton ESP et tu cherches « Target1 X ». Une fois trouvé, tu cliques dessus. Tu as alors accès à l’historique récent. Si tu veux remonter plus loin dans le temps, cliques sur « Afficher plus ». Tu as ainsi l’historique des positions X de ta cible 1.
Pour la position Y, tu refais la même chose avec « Target1 Y ». Tu peux aussi vérifier les cibles 2 et 3.

Autre chose, n’oublis pas que le LD2450 traverse les murs. Il peut aussi traverser le sol ou le plafond s’il a été positionné trop haut ou trop bas. HLK préconise de le placer au mur à 1,5m. De plus, dans certains cas, l’onde millimétrique peut ricocher.
Le mieux a faire c’est d’utiliser le ploty-graph depuis son smartphone ou sa tablette et de visualiser ta position perçu par le capteur à différent endroit de la pièce.

Merci pour ta reponse, du coup le tiens tu le laisse droit ou tu l’inclines vers le bas?

en regardant les captures, on dirait qu’il y a 2 elements qui le ferait declancher.

a 7m y a une cloison ou y a le lit de mon fils derriere peut etre ca



Je le laisse droit.

De ce que je lis il y a eu un seul événement à plus de 7m devant et 2m sur la droite. J’en déduis que c’est là où dors ton fils. (Pour info, quand on s’imagine dos au mur l’axe X est inversé dans le fichier YAML. J’ai corrigé ça dans la version sur mon github). Même si globalement le LD2450 détecte jusqu’à 6m, il peut aller jusqu’à 8m. (voir datasheet page 10)

Ma recommandation est de travailler par zone tant que possible.

Avec 3 zones paramétrables, plus une d’exclusion, on peut faire déjà beaucoup de chose. J’ai réécris le code d’origine pour améliorer le capteur dans ce sens. Une fois que j’ai paramétré mes zones, je désactive les informations de cible (target). Je ne reçois plus que des informations de zone: soit la zone est active, soit non. Et si tu as plusieurs capteurs qui balayent la même pièce, tu peux créer un capteur virtuel unique qui prend en compte les informations de différentes zones balayées. Ainsi dans tes scripts ou automations tu feras uniquement appel à un seul capteur virtuel et pas à plusieurs réels

Pour l’instant je travaille sur un autre sujet, mais j’ai bien l’intention de mettre à jour mon programme avant l’été pour ajouter de nouvelles zones d’exclusion. Ainsi cette été, quand j’aurai les fenêtres ouvertes, je pourrais exclure les mouvements des rideaux.

Merci, je viens d’upload ton fichier, je vais créer les zones ce soir, on verra ca :slight_smile: Merci encore

Je viens de faire ton fichier mais quand je suis dans une zone, la zone reste à 0. All target me compte bien.
As tu une idée ? Merci :blush:

Est-ce que tu utilises le graphe (1) que j’ai fournis pour voir ta position ?
Si oui as-tu vérifié que target x et y (2) sont bien a l’intérieur de la zone que tu as défini (3) ?

Dans le fichier dans le fichier YAML utiliser le ld2450 qui tourne partout sur internet, la position X est inversé. Ce que j’ai rectifié dans le mien. Il pourrait donc que tu ne sois pas dans la zone choisie.


dans ton cas c’est bien dans la zone 1 qu’il faut que tu regardes mais par rapport à la capture d’écran que j’ai fait il faudrait vérifier dans la zone 2

Merci ta reponse,
regarde mes captures
qu’en penses tu?

Merci a toi

ldzone5


ldzone3

ldzone1

Il faut tu inverses tes valeurs en Y. 500 dans le début et 4000 dans la fin

Salut, super merci c’etait ca, j’y ai meme pas pensé car sur le schema ca change rien :)))

1 « J'aime »

Je ne suis pas un habitué de github et je ne comprends pas ce qui bloque le PR ?
Et surtout qui peut le faire avancer ou pas

Hello Nico, désolé je déterre un vieux sujet, j’ignore si tu as résolu ton problème de fausse détection mais les capteurs millimétriques détecte les mouvements d’air ( c’est grâce à ça qu’il peut savoir qu’une personne statique est encore dans la pièce). Donc je pense que c’est ta baie qui trigger le détecteur, car cela doit générer une montée de masse d’air chaud.

Normalement il devrait te suffire de descendre la sensibilité initiale de détection. Bien souvent les détecteurs attendent de détecter un grand mouvement afin de se déclencher et ensuite donner un status plus précis ( Large mouvement, Puit, il fait la différence avec Small et Statique )

j’arrive sûrement un peu tard pour toi mais la doc (en chinois :roll_eyes:) précise qu’il est censé être mis contre un mur à 1,50 ou 2m.
pour le mettre dans un boîtier il n’y a pas de problème par contre la doc préconise d’avoir une épaisseur max de 1 mm en fonction de la matière utilisée.

1 « J'aime »

Ok merci.
J’ai reçu ma commande Aliexpress, mais déçu ! La moitié fonctionne pas.
Je vais recommander de meilleure qualité et faire d’autres tests.

Tu as pris lesquels ?